Purpose
The purpose of this memorandum is to recommend approval to the Board of Mayor and Aldermen (BOMA) of Change Order No. 5 (Final Change Order) to the construction contract with SiteSolutions/The Parkes Companies, Inc. for the 3rd Avenue North Extension Project (Bicentennial Park Phase I)(COF Contract No. 2012-0089).
Background
The 3rd Avenue North Extension (Bicentennial Park Phase I) construction contract was awarded by BOMA to The Parkes Companies, Inc. on August 14, 2012, for $4,795,129.72. The anticipated project completion was September 2013. Change Order No. 1 was approved by BOMA on October 23, 2012, for a decrease of $416,362.43. It replaced some existing bid line items with the alternate Redi-Rock Wall bid line items, causing a substantial cost savings. Change Order No. 2 was approved by BOMA on January 8, 2013, which included small changes required to properly complete the project, but no contract price increase. Change Order No. 3, a cost increase of $242,409.68, was approved on February 12, 2013, and included adding limestone caps for the bridge, Redi-Rock bridge headwall and a credit for reducing the size of our water main from 10" to 6". Change Order No. 4 was approved by BOMA on August 8, 2013, included a time extension of 120 days for a total contract time of 485 calendar days (originally 365, plus 120).
